A career retrospective the album tracks steely dan from their more group oriented beginning which found legendary guitarist jeff skunk baxter in the lineup to their more withdrawn period in the second half of their career when becker and fagen focused on the perfectionism allowed by the studio environment.

Steely dan have sold more than 30 million albums worldwide and helped define the soundtrack of the 70s with hits including f m reelin in the years rikki don t lose that number peg and hey nineteen amongst others culled from their seven platinum albums issued between 1972 and 1980.

Review emerging from new york s brill building in the early 70s songwriting duo walter becker and donald fagen were two smart jewish kids raised on jazz and with a healthy cynicism about the so called music business and its attendant follies.
